Paramount Pictures has given fans a taste of what to expect from 'Scary Movie' 6 by unveiling the teaser poster for the upcoming parody film. The poster features a blend of Ghostface from the 'Scream' franchise and Aunt Gladys from the 2025 supernatural horror film 'Weapons.' The image features the tagline, "Aunt You Gladys I’m Back?" with the title 'Scary Movie' followed by the film's theatrical release date, June 5. The 'Weapons' antagonist, Aunt Gladys, played by Amy Madigan, became the talk of the town after she won the Oscar for Best Supporting Actress on March 15. The poster, which was dropped hours after Madigan's win, is captioned, "Mad props Aunt Gladys. #Oscars #ScaryMovie." 

In April 2024, Miramax announced that the next installment in the long-running parody franchise was being developed. 'Scary Movie' 6 is written by Rick Alvarez and the Wayans brothers — Marlon, Shawn, Craig, and Keenan Ivory. It is directed by Michael Tiddes, whose previous credits include 'A Haunted House' and 'A Haunted House 2.' The first trailer for the upcoming movie was released on March 2, and it gave fans a glimpse of what to expect. In keeping with the tradition of parodying popular horror titles and characters, 'Scary Movie' 6 will spoof the four-time Oscar-winning film 'Sinners,' along with 'Terrifier 3,' 'A Quiet Place,' 'Get Out,' 'Halloween,' 'Weapons,' 'M3GAN,' 'Annabelle,' 'The Substance,' the recent 'Scream' films, and others.

'Scary Movie' 6 is scheduled to release in theaters on June 5. The title will see Cindy Campbell (Anna Faris) reunite with her friends Ray Wilkins (Shawn Wayans), Shorty Meeks (Marlon Wayans), and Brenda Meeks (Regina Hall) to fight the same masked killer they encountered 26 years ago in the first film. Returning cast members include Jon Abrahams as Bobby Prinze, Dave Sheridan as Doofy Gilmore, Lochlyn Munro as Greg, Anthony Anderson as Mahalik, Cheri Oteri as Gail Hailstorm, and Chris Elliott as Hanson. They will be joined by the new cast members, Kim Wayans, Cameron Scott Roberts, Damon Wayans Jr., Olivia Rose Keegan, Gregg Wayans, Savannah Lee Nassif, Ruby Snowber, Heidi Gardner, Felissa Rose, Sydney Park, and Benny Zielke.

The comedy spoof franchise is being revived after 13 years, with the last film, 'Scary Movie 5,' having been released in theaters on April 12, 2013. Moreover, the film brings back the franchise's original creators, the Wayans brothers, who exited the film series after 'Scary Movie 2' over creative differences. Fans are excited about their involvement as they played a big role in the franchise's long-lasting popularity.
